1. Set Realistic Goals
The first step towards successful weight loss is setting realistic goals. Instead of aiming for a dramatic transformation overnight, focus on achievable milestones. Break down your ultimate goal into smaller, manageable targets. This approach allows you to stay motivated as you see progress along the way.
2. Create a Balanced Diet Plan
Nutrition plays a crucial role in weight loss. A balanced diet includes a variety of foods from all food groups. Focus on incorporating lean proteins, whole grains, fruits, vegetables, and healthy fats into your meals. Avoid extreme diets or strict restrictions, as they often lead to short-term results and unsustainable habits.
3. Practice Portion Control
Portion control is essential to prevent overeating. Use smaller plates, pay attention to portion sizes, and listen to your body’s hunger cues. Eating mindfully can help you enjoy your food more and avoid unnecessary calorie consumption.
4. Stay Hydrated
Drinking enough water is often overlooked but is crucial for weight loss. Water can help control appetite, flush out toxins, and support your metabolism. Aim for at least eight glasses of water per day and consider drinking a glass before meals to reduce overeating.
5. Regular Exercise
Incorporate regular physical activity into your routine. A combination of cardio and strength training exercises can help you burn calories and build muscle. Find activities you enjoy to make exercise a sustainable part of your life.
6. Get Adequate Sleep
Sleep is often underestimated in its role in weight management. Lack of sleep can disrupt hormones that control hunger and appetite, leading to overeating.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ep per night to support your weight loss efforts.
7. Manage Stress
Stress can lead to emotional eating and unhealthy food choices. Practice stress-reduction techniques such as meditation, deep breathing, or yoga to help manage stress and maintain a healthy mindset during your weight loss journey.
8. Track Your Progress
Keeping track of your meals, exercise, and progress can be a powerful motivator. Use a journal or a mobile app to record your daily activities and monitor changes in your weight and body measurements.
9. Seek Support
Weight loss can be a challenging journey, and having a support system can make a significant difference. Consider joining a weight loss group, talking to a friend, or consulting a registered dietitian or personal trainer for guidance and encouragement.
10. Be Patient and Persistent
Last but not least, remember that weight loss is not always linear. There will be ups and downs along the way, but persistence is key. Celebrate your successes, learn from setbacks, and stay committed to your long-term health goals.
